THE Gladstone region's engineers took to the spotlight on Wednesday night as the best of the best took part in the annual 2008 Engineers Australia Local Engineering Awards
The awards are aimed at recognising the talents and skills of engineers from the local region and were presented by the Queensland president of Engineers Australia, Michael Ganza.
There was strong interest in the awards this year with nominations coming from Bechtel, Connell Wagner, GHD, Matrikon, NRG, Orica, Queensland Alumina Limited, Rio Tinto Alcan Yarwun, Thomas & Coffey and Worley Parsons.
The winner of Professional Engineer of the Year was Kevin Baillie from Bechtel. The winner of the Young Professional Engineer of the Year was Leah Barlow from Orica.
Kevin and Leah will both receive tickets, flights and accommodation to the Queensland Engineering Excellence Awards in Brisbane on October. 17
Kevin said yesterday he was humbled by the honour bestowed upon him by his peers.
The 63-year-old, who these days divides his time between Rio Tinto projects in Newcastle and Gladstone, has been in the profession for 39 years.
He moved to Gladstone in December 1969 and worked in various positions with QAL until 1998.
"Now it's a matter of seeing what I can do for the up-and-coming generation of engineers," he said.
"We have a wonderfully talented and capable bunch of engineers working in the profession working in an around Gladstone." Leah who is operations manager at Orica said she was excited with her win.
"It's an honour to have to gain such an award from such a talented group people." She said she enjoyed chemical engineering and business but didn't want to be stuck in a lab.
"It's great being out on the plant doing the implementation work and getting your hands dirty," she said.
